Singijani is a Rural village located in Matia, Goalpara, Assam.
The total population of Singijani is 731.
Singijani village comprises 162 households.
The literacy rate in Singijani is 88.6%. Among the literate population of 577, there are 299 literate males and 278 literate females.
In Singijani, there are 349 males and 382 females, with a sex ratio of 1095 females per 1000 males.
There are 80 children (10.9% of population), comprising 35 boys and 45 girls.
The total number of workers in Singijani is 440, with 328 main workers and 112 marginal workers.
In Singijani,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 439 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(211 males, 228 females).
Singijani is located in Assam state, Goalpara district, and falls under Matia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 282334 and LGD code is 282334.
